Sanhu Zhao is a scholar working on Organic Chemistry, Molecular Biology and Catalysis. According to data from OpenAlex, Sanhu Zhao has authored 41 papers receiving a total of 741 indexed citations (citations by other indexed papers that have themselves been cited), including 19 papers in Organic Chemistry, 8 papers in Molecular Biology and 8 papers in Catalysis. Recurrent topics in Sanhu Zhao’s work include Chemical Synthesis and Reactions (13 papers), Multicomponent Synthesis of Heterocycles (9 papers) and Asymmetric Synthesis and Catalysis (7 papers). Sanhu Zhao is often cited by papers focused on Chemical Synthesis and Reactions (13 papers), Multicomponent Synthesis of Heterocycles (9 papers) and Asymmetric Synthesis and Catalysis (7 papers). Sanhu Zhao collaborates with scholars based in China. Sanhu Zhao's co-authors include Liwei Zhang, Zhaobin Chen, Xiaoju Wang, Caixia Yin, Yongbin Zhang, Fangjun Huo, Liheng Feng, Jue Chen, Qin Zhang and Xiaoyu Zhang and has published in prestigious journals such as Angewandte Chemie International Edition, FEBS Letters and Journal of neurosurgery.
